Overview of the Delta-Q Battery Charger

The Delta-Q battery charger is a high-efficiency, intelligent charging solution designed for industrial and recreational applications. Known for its reliability and advanced technology, it supports various battery types, including lead-acid and lithium-ion. The charger features customizable charging profiles and algorithms, allowing users to tailor charging processes for specific needs. With models like the QuiQ and IC Series, it offers scalable solutions for different voltage systems. Its high power factor correction ensures grid-friendly operation, making it suitable for global use. The charger is built with durable components, ensuring long-term performance and minimal maintenance. Its user-friendly interface and LED indicators provide clear charge status updates, enhancing user experience and efficiency.

General Safety Guidelines

Always handle the Delta-Q charger with care to prevent accidents. Ensure proper installation by a qualified technician and avoid exposing the charger to water or moisture. Use the correct connectors and cables to prevent electrical hazards. Keep the charger away from flammable materials and ensure good ventilation to avoid overheating; Never modify the charger or bypass safety features, as this can lead to serious risks. Wear protective gear, such as gloves and safety glasses, when working with batteries. Regularly inspect the charger and cables for damage, and avoid overloading the system. Follow all manufacturer guidelines to ensure safe and reliable operation. Proper maintenance and adherence to these guidelines will help prevent injuries and prolong the charger’s lifespan.

Battery Safety Information

Proper battery handling is crucial for safety. Always ensure the battery is compatible with the Delta-Q charger to avoid damage or hazards. Store batteries in a cool, dry place, away from flammable materials. Prevent short circuits by keeping terminals covered and avoiding contact with metal objects. Use protective gear when handling batteries, and never overcharge or discharge them. Monitor battery temperature during charging and avoid using damaged or aged batteries. Follow the manufacturer’s guidelines for charging cycles and capacity limits. Regularly inspect batteries for signs of wear or swelling, and replace them if necessary. Proper care extends battery life and ensures safe operation.

Connecting the Charger to the Battery

Connect the charger to the battery by aligning the positive and negative terminals with the corresponding plugs. Ensure the connectors are securely fastened to avoid loose connections. Double-check the polarity to prevent damage to the charger or battery. Verify the charger is turned off before making connections. Once connected, confirm the charger recognizes the battery by checking the LED indicators. Ensure the charger is placed in a well-ventilated area, away from flammable materials. Follow the manual’s wiring diagram for specific instructions. Proper connections are critical for safe and efficient charging. Always refer to the manual for model-specific guidance to avoid errors;

Understanding Charging Profiles

Charging profiles are predefined algorithms that dictate how the Delta-Q charger interacts with your battery. These profiles optimize charging for specific battery chemistries, such as lead-acid or lithium-ion, ensuring efficient and safe charging. By selecting the correct profile, you can maximize battery performance, extend lifespan, and prevent damage. The charger stores up to 10 profiles, allowing flexibility for different applications. Each profile adjusts parameters like voltage, current, and charging stages to match the battery’s needs. Understanding these profiles helps you tailor the charging process, ensuring your battery receives the optimal charge every time. This customization enhances reliability and maintains battery health over time.

Updating Software and Firmware

Regular software and firmware updates are essential for optimal performance of your Delta-Q charger. Visit the Delta-Q Technologies website to check for the latest updates. Download the appropriate software version for your charger model, such as IC650, IC900, or IC1200. Follow the on-screen instructions to install the update. Ensure the charger is connected to a power source during the update process to avoid interruptions. Updating enhances features, improves compatibility, and resolves potential issues. Refer to the manual for detailed steps or contact technical support if assistance is needed. Keeping your charger updated ensures it operates efficiently and supports advanced charging algorithms.

Understanding LED Indicators

The LED indicators on your Delta-Q battery charger provide critical status updates. A steady green light indicates successful charging or completion, while a flashing green light signals active charging; Yellow LEDs often denote fault conditions or errors, such as communication issues or improper connections. A red light alerts you to critical problems like overvoltage or thermal faults. Specific patterns, like a flashing yellow and red combination, may indicate software updates or calibration needs. Refer to the manual for detailed codes and troubleshooting guidance. Always check the LED display first when diagnosing issues to ensure safe and efficient operation of your charger.

Interpreting Charge Status

The Delta-Q charger uses a combination of LED indicators and display messages to show charge status. A steady green light and “Complete” message indicate the battery is fully charged. A flashing green light signals active charging in progress. If a yellow light appears with a “Fault” message, it may indicate issues like overtemperature or communication errors. Red lights with “Error” messages suggest critical problems requiring immediate attention. The charger also displays charge percentage, voltage, and current. Always monitor these indicators to track charging progress and address issues promptly. This ensures safe and efficient charging, prolonging battery life and system reliability.
